Auburn releases list of city roads to be repaved in 2018

The city will have nearly $953,000 to work with to fix some of Auburn’s worst streets this year.

During a presentation to the Auburn City Council Thursday night, city civil engineer Scott McIntyre outlined the city’s plan for the 2018 road program. The roads scheduled to be repaved this year include:

• Cottage Street from North Division Street to Washington Street

• Mahaney Avenue from VanAnden Street to Seymour Street

• North Herman Avenue from Franklin Street to Tyler Drive

• Englewood Avenue from Lexington Avenue to Kensington Avenue

• Fitch Avenue from South Street to 58 Fitch Ave.

• Oak Street from Cottrell Street to Ashbaugh Avenue

• South Marvine Avenue from East Genesee Street to Walnut Street

• Dennis Street from Kearney Avenue to Lake Avenue.
